After an enlightening discussion with one of our board members and friend a few days ago, as well as with Carol – just last night, I want you to know that we are not in this ministry just to make marriages better. Our ultimate aim is to help the leaders with whom we work and serve know how loved they are by our Father so they can love well at home, at work, in the community, and to the uttermost parts of the earth. Jesus said that is how they’d know “we are His disciples”. He said it is the “greatest and second greatest commandments”. He said all “the law and the prophets hang on these two commandments”. So our bottom line is to experience God’s love to such an extent that we love Him and serve Him humbly no matter our circumstances or the responses of those we love. In that way we will love as Jesus loves and keep His new commandment so clearly stated in John 13: 34-35. So, loving God and others is not for our comfort or pleasure (though it may lead to both); it is for the glory and worship of the One Who deserves all praise and our deepest submission, even Jesus Christ our Lord.
